Course Details

Art History Foundation: Understanding the historical context of art and its evolution over time is crucial for art critique. This unit will cover major art movements, styles, and techniques from ancient to contemporary times. • Art Analysis Techniques: In this unit, students will learn various art analysis techniques, such as formal analysis, contextual analysis, and symbolic interpretation. They will also explore how to use these methods to evaluate works of art. • Critique Writing Skills: Students will develop their writing skills to produce clear, concise, and well-argued art critiques. This unit will cover the structure of critique writing, including introductory statements, thesis development, and supporting evidence. • Art Vocabulary and Terminology: A comprehensive understanding of art vocabulary and terminology is essential for effective art critique. This unit will cover key terms and concepts in art history, criticism, and theory. • Aesthetics and Criticism: This unit will explore the philosophical underpinnings of art criticism, including the nature of beauty, taste, and aesthetic judgment. Students will learn how to apply these concepts to their own art critiques. • Contemporary Art Critique: In this unit, students will learn how to critique contemporary art, including installation, performance, and digital art. They will also explore the role of art criticism in the contemporary art world. • Diversity and Inclusion in Art Critique: This unit will cover the importance of diversity and inclusion in art critique, including the representation of marginalized communities and artists. Students will learn how to approach art critiques with a critical and inclusive lens. • Art Critique Ethics: In this unit, students will explore the ethical considerations of art critique, including issues of objectivity, bias, and confidentiality. They will learn how to navigate these issues in their own art critiques.
